About

Chi Chen is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Materials Chemistry and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Chi Chen has authored 76 papers receiving a total of 2.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 33 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 27 papers in Materials Chemistry and 16 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Chi Chen's work include Quantum Dots Synthesis And Properties (18 papers), Advanced biosensing and bioanalysis techniques (15 papers) and Advancements in Battery Materials (9 papers). Chi Chen is often cited by papers focused on Quantum Dots Synthesis And Properties (18 papers), Advanced biosensing and bioanalysis techniques (15 papers) and Advancements in Battery Materials (9 papers). Chi Chen coll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and France. Chi Chen's co-authors include Niko Hildebrandt, Bisheng Yang, Lintao Cai, Ping Gong, Hui Yang, Zhiqing Zou, Duyang Gao, Qingqing Cheng, Guanhui Gao and Zonghai Sheng and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Advanced Materials and Angewandte Chemie International Edition.
